Mirage in Tiger Meet, 1/200

The NATO Tiger Meet is an almost annual event, a get-together of NATO flying units with a tiger in the unit's crest, the Tiger Meet.

Details are found on the website http://www.cavok-aviation-photos.net/NTM04.html just in case you're interested.

Anyway, some information is copied and pasted here for convenience sake.
"First held in 1961 at the now closed RAF Woodbridge. During the sixties and seventies more and more units joined the club initially just comprising the RAF's No. 74 sq, the USAFE's 79 TFS and the French Air Force's EC 1/12 "Cambresis". The latter one is the sole surviver of the original trio. Over the years, the Tiger Meet evolved from a social get-together to a real flying exercise. "

What I have got here is a Mirage NTM 2004 version. Should be a Mirage 2000RDI but I'm using Cafe's Mirage III just for fun. The real plane flew in Schleswing-Jagel, Germany, in the 2004 NATO Tiger Meet event. What attracted me most is the staring eyes of the big cat. In order not to hijack Cafe's thread, I'm moving here to start maybe a NTM series of Mirages. The pattern is found on the net but of course you have to do a LOT of paint work to adjust and migrate the graphics to the model.
